Why does the job exist?
This position will perform independent field inspections, testing and documentation and may also include reviewing contract documents and other office duties for construction projects as needed to ensure State and Federal specification compliance. This position may be assigned to work throughout District Four to meet the demands of the Construction Program.
How does it get done?
Perform materials testing on New Mexico Department of Transportation construction projects. Review and interpret construction plans and contracts. Document contractor activities, materials and equipment on New Mexico Department of Transportation project. Ensure that the contractor is installing materials that meet compliance.
Who are the customers?
The traveling public.

Ideal Candidate Ideal Candidate The ideal candidate will have experience: -Reviewing/Interpreting construction plans and drawings. -Calculating mathematical computations such as volume and area. -Working with Microsoft Office software to produce reports and/or spreadsheets. -Documenting contractor activities, materials and equipment -Testing field materials. Minimum Qualification High School Diploma or equivalent and two (2) years of relevant experience. Any combination of education from an accredited college or university in a related field and/or direct experience in this occupation totaling two (2) years may substitute for the required experience. Substitution Table These combinations of education and experience qualify you for the position: Education Experience 1 High School Diploma or Equivalent AND 2 years of experience 2 Associate's degree or higher (Bachelor's, Master's) AND 0 years of experience Education and years of experience must be related to the purpose of the position. If Minimum Qualification requires a specific number of "semester hours" in a field (e.g. 6 semester hours in Accounting), applicants MUST have those semester hours in order to meet the minimum qualifications. No substitutions apply for semester hours. Employment Requirements Must possess and maintain a valid Driver's License.
